UKRAINE : HOW THEY QUALIFIED
The Ukraine became the first European team to qualify
for the World Cup, clinching a spot on the strength
of a 1-1 draw with Georgia in Tbilisi, Georgia in on
September 3, 2005. The tie and the fact that Turkey
played Denmark to a 2-2 draw helped the Ukrainians (7-1-4,
25 points) capture the Europe Group 2 title. What made
it more rewarding was that the Ukraine overcame 2002
World Cup teams Turkey and Denmark and Euro 2004 champion
Greece. Ukrainians celebrated the next day, pouring
Soviet champagne over the players, who danced around
in a circle celebrating in Kiev. "It is impossible
to put into words the feeling and excitement about the
result we have already achieved," goalkeeper Olexander
Shovkovsky told Reuters. "We have achieved the
goal that other generations of Ukrainian footballers
only dreamt of."
QUALIFYING RESULTS
9/4/04 Denmark 1, Ukraine 1
9/8/04 Kazakhstan 1, Ukraine 0
10/9/04 Ukraine 1, Greece 1
10/13/04 Ukraine 2, Georgia 0
11/17/04 Turkey 0, Ukraine 3
2/9/05 Albania 0, Ukraine 2
3/30/05 Ukraine 1, Denmark 0
6/4/05 Ukraine 2, Kazakhstan 0
6/8/05 Greece 0, Ukraine 1
9/3/05 Georgia 1, Ukraine 1
9/7/05 Ukraine 0, Turkey 1
10/8/05 Ukraine 2, Albania 2
